Plasma Cell Alloantigen 1 and IL-10 Secretion Define Two Distinct Peritoneal B1a B Cell Subsets With Opposite Functions, PC1(high) Cells Being Protective and PC1(low) Cells Harmful for the Growing Fetus
B cells possess various immuno regulatory functions. However, research about their participation in tolerance induction toward the fetus is just emerging.
